When Bellamy Price decides to write a novel, the childhood murder of her own older sister insists on becoming its subject. Published under a pseudonym, this debut fiction becomes a runaway bestseller, but the tranquility of her newfound fame dissolves when an enterprising reporter penetrates the secret behind its origin. This unwelcome media attention soon brings a more immediate threat: Somebody is stalking Bellamy and their motive is as unclear as his or her identity. Sandra Brown's Low Pressure drops its protagonist and readers into an intense situation in which solving a past homicide is the only way to prevent a future one. Now in trade paperback and NOOK Book.
